2020-10-05

    科技2022-08-01  133

    Javaweb HTML的表单标记

    1,html 制作表单,jsp接受数据并显示在网页上 1.在HTML中设置表单,制作一个信息界面 包括姓名,密码,爱好,班级,等。

    Index.html:

    姓名: 密码: 性别:男 女 班级://下拉列表框 一班 二班 三班 </select></br> 爱好: <input type="checkbox" name="j" value="音乐">音乐 <input type="checkbox" name="j" value="运动">运动 <input type="checkbox" name="j" value="电影">电影 <input type="checkbox" name="j" value="编程">编程 个人说明:</br> <textarea name="h" rows="4" cols="20" >填写个人说明</textarea>><!--输入框中的默认值--> </br> <input type="submit" value="提交"/> </form>> 界面展示: ![在这里插入图片描述](https://img-blog.csdnimg.cn/20201010173236870.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L20wXzUxMDU2MjA3,size_16,color_FFFFFF,t_70#pic_center)

    Newjsp1.jsp: <%@page contentType=“text/html” pageEncoding=“UTF-8”%>

    爱好这个选项使用的是多行文本标记,所以在显示的时候要使用一个字符串数组来展示 <%String s[]=request.getParameterValues(“j”); String a=""; for(int i=1;i<s.length;i++)a=a+""+s[i]; %>


    填写的资料为

    姓名:<%=request.getParameter("n")%> 密码:<%=request.getParameter("p")%> 性别:<%=request.getParameter("s")%> 爱好:<%=a%> 班级:<%=request.getParameter("b")%> 个人说明;<%=request.getParameter("h")%> 界面展示: ![在这里插入图片描述](https://img-blog.csdnimg.cn/20201010173208827.png?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L20wXzUxMDU2MjA3,size_16,color_FFFFFF,t_70#pic_center)
    Processed: 0.013, SQL: 8